Medium Composition Affecting In Vitro Masspropagation and Morphogenesis in Prothalli of Pteris cretica 'Wilsonii' (Pteris cretica 'Wilsonii'의 전엽체 기내 대량번식 및 형태형성에 미치는 배지 구성물질 및 배양 방법)

  • The most effective conditions of in vitro culture were studied for mass propagation of Pteris cretica 'Wilsonii'. Spores of the species germinated within 7 weeks. The greatest proliferation was obtained with Knop and Hyponex media, but growth was more effective in Hyponex medium. MS medium induced necrosis of prothalli in all strength of nitrogen and sucrose except in case of 0% sucrose. Hyponex medium supplemented with 1% sucrose and 0.6% agar promoted propagation and growth of prothalli. In Hyponex medium, optimal inoculation method was homogenization, but in MS medium dividing colonies of prothalli was more effective. Culturing on solid medium was more effective than liquid culture method. Liquid culture induced necrosis of prothalli. Shaking cultured prothalli showed good growth, but propagation was inhibited compared to those cultured on solid medium.
